Graded Tight End Traits:

  • Athleticism: 8/10 (Appears to a very smooth athlete with good burst)
  • Durability: 7/10 (Had multiple different injuries this year that culminated in him missing the Rose Bowl and almost missing the Pac-12 Championship. While he played through them they did add up and could carry over to his nfl career)
  • Hands: 9/10 (Will be a dependable target with great catch radius. Not as sure handed on low or behind passes but excellent at high pointing)
  • RAC Ability: 8/10 (Pretty elusive and will even throw in a juke move or two. Strength allows him to go through defenders 
  • Run Blocking: 7/10 (A very willing blocker especially as a lead. Pretty successful when form is correct. Too often he just tries to hit the players instead of actually getting his hands on them. Should be correctable)
  • Route Running: 5/10 (His route tree is extremely limited. His tape is full of comebacks drags and go routes. It does not seem like they asked him to run many double routes. The few times he did it looked awkward and slot compared to his athleticism and speed. This is the area that needs the most work)
  • Speed: 8/10 (Possesses very good speed for a tight end. Has the potential to run away from linebackers in coverage)
  • Strength: 7/10 (Good strength as a blocker when form is correct and as a runner. Defensive backs will have a hard time preventing extra yards against him)

Player Summary:

Kincaid is on the older side for a prospect at 23, but he is still an elite talent at the tight end positon. He is a very good athlete that has the speed to win vertically, and the hands to be reliable underneath. His strength is surprisingly good compared to his average size at the position and he is a very willing blocker. His route running needs work both in nuance and diversification but this should not be an issue. He high points very well and can impact the game at all levels.
